Addis Ababa Institute of Technology

University

Save all the places you've visited.

Create your Travel Map like this!

Other best places near Addis Ababa Institute of Technology

park icon

Tree

park

1.3 km

Things to do near Addis Ababa Institute of TechnologyBest places in Addis Ababa